- /****************************************************************************
- * Name: insmod
- *
- * Description:
- * Verify that the file is an ELF module binary and, if so, load the
- * module into kernel memory and initialize it for use.
- *
- * NOTE: modlib_setsymtab() had to have been called in board-specific OS
- * logic prior to calling this function from application logic (perhaps via
- * boardctl(BOARDIOC_OS_SYMTAB). Otherwise, insmod will be unable to
- * resolve symbols in the OS module.
- *
- * Input Parameters:
- *
- * filename - Full path to the module binary to be loaded
- * modname - The name that can be used to refer to the module after
- * it has been loaded.
- *
- * Returned Value:
- * A non-NULL module handle that can be used on subsequent calls to other
- * module interfaces is returned on success. If insmod() was unable to
- * load the module insmod() will return a NULL handle and the errno
- * variable will be set appropriately.
- *
- ****************************************************************************/
- FAR void *insmod(FAR const char *filename, FAR const char *modname)
- {
- struct mod_loadinfo_s loadinfo;
- FAR struct module_s *modp;
- mod_initializer_t initializer;
- int ret;
- DEBUGASSERT(filename != NULL && modname != NULL);
- binfo("Loading file: %s\n", filename);
- /* Get exclusive access to the module registry */
- modlib_registry_lock();
- /* Check if this module is already installed */
- if (modlib_registry_find(modname) != NULL)
- {
- modlib_registry_unlock();
- ret = -EEXIST;
- goto errout_with_lock;
- }
- /* Initialize the ELF library to load the program binary. */
- ret = modlib_initialize(filename, &loadinfo);
- mod_dumploadinfo(&loadinfo);
- if (ret != 0)
- {
- berr("ERROR: Failed to initialize to load module: %d\n", ret);
- goto errout_with_lock;
- }
- /* Allocate a module registry entry to hold the module data */
- modp = (FAR struct module_s *)kmm_zalloc(sizeof(struct module_s));
- if (ret != 0)
- {
- binfo("Failed to initialize for load of ELF program: %d\n", ret);
- goto errout_with_loadinfo;
- }
- /* Save the module name in the registry entry */
- strncpy(modp->modname, modname, MODLIB_NAMEMAX);
- /* Load the program binary */
- ret = modlib_load(&loadinfo);
- mod_dumploadinfo(&loadinfo);
- if (ret != 0)
- {
- binfo("Failed to load ELF program binary: %d\n", ret);
- goto errout_with_registry_entry;
- }
- /* Bind the program to the kernel symbol table */
- ret = modlib_bind(modp, &loadinfo);
- if (ret != 0)
- {
- binfo("Failed to bind symbols program binary: %d\n", ret);
- goto errout_with_load;
- }
- /* Save the load information */
- modp->alloc = (FAR void *)loadinfo.textalloc;
- #if defined(CONFIG_FS_PROCFS) && !defined(CONFIG_FS_PROCFS_EXCLUDE_MODULE)
- modp->textsize = loadinfo.textsize;
- modp->datasize = loadinfo.datasize;
- #endif
- /* Get the module initializer entry point */
- initializer = (mod_initializer_t)(loadinfo.textalloc + loadinfo.ehdr.e_entry);
- #if defined(CONFIG_FS_PROCFS) && !defined(CONFIG_FS_PROCFS_EXCLUDE_MODULE)
- modp->initializer = initializer;
- #endif
- mod_dumpinitializer(initializer, &loadinfo);
- /* Call the module initializer */
- ret = initializer(&modp->modinfo);
- if (ret < 0)
- {
- binfo("Failed to initialize the module: %d\n", ret);
- goto errout_with_load;
- }
- /* Add the new module entry to the registry */
- modlib_registry_add(modp);
- modlib_uninitialize(&loadinfo);
- modlib_registry_unlock();
- return (FAR void *)modp;
- errout_with_load:
- modlib_unload(&loadinfo);
- (void)modlib_undepend(modp);
- errout_with_registry_entry:
- kmm_free(modp);
- errout_with_loadinfo:
- modlib_uninitialize(&loadinfo);
- errout_with_lock:
- modlib_registry_unlock();
- set_errno(-ret);
- return NULL;
- }
